  • Page 5: Definitions

    •  Check whether the machine starts with a 110V pulse (3 seconds) on the direction wires (brown wire  for forward and orange wire for reverse). •  Check whether the machine changes direction with a 110V pulse (3 seconds) on the direction wires  (brown wire for forward and orange wire for reverse). •  Check whether the machine stops and remains stopped 5 seconds after opening the return safety  circuit (disconnecting the yellow wire for 5 sec.). •  Check that the neutral and earth wires are connected together inside the main panel. Note: The main panel of the pivot must be equipped with the autoreverse relays and it must be configured  in autoreverse mode to be able to change direction. Note: In machines from other manufacturers, the colour scheme might be different. It might also be neces- sary to install additional electronic components for the controller to be able to execute the start, stop and  change direction functions properly. After checking this functionality, you can install the iControl Remote. Should they not work properly, contact our technical service for assistance. iControl Remote Installation Manual...
  • Page 6: Installation, Connections And Commissioning

    • For pivots with the Standard Autoreverse panel type: a)  Connect the YELLOW/RED wire of the span cable to Terminal 4 in the terminal block of the Last  Tower Box. In step 7, the iControl Remote will be fed at 110V using the connection of the YELLOW/ RED wire to terminal T23 in the main panel. b)  Connect the PINK wire of the span cable to Terminal 12 in the terminal block of the Last Tower Box  for the iControl Remote to be able to control a pump/valve. In step 7, the PINK wire will be con- nected to Terminal T24 of the main panel. Note: For all the iControl Remote controllers of SAR (Standard AutoReverse) type, it is possible to  control the End gun from the Pivot Panel using the pink line, but in this case the pump/valve control  functionality will be lost. To be able to control the gun / Cannon from the pivot panel, the pink wire  must be connected to Terminal no. 9 (instead of no. 12) in the terminal block of the Last Tower Box.  In step 7, the pink line will be connected to Terminal T3 (instead of Terminal T24) in the main panel. •     For iControl Remote to be able to control the End Gun Solenoid, this must be con                nected to Terminal 11 in the Last Tower Box.     •     Connect the light in the last tower to A1 at the motor contactor 3.   Install the water pressure sensor kit and connect it to the M12 connector of iControl Remote. Note: The sensor must be installed vertically above the span pipe to prevent freezing of water inside it         during winter. Make sure the drains and in particular the last tower drain are open before the first frost hits. 4.   (Optional) The iControl Remote controller can control a second End Gun or a fertigation pump. The          installation requires opening the iControl Remote v2 cover and connecting a wire to the OUT20  ...
  • Page 7 For pivots with BASIC A/R panel: The PINK wire should be connected to Terminal T7 instead of  Terminal T3. From this moment, iControl Remote will have a supply voltage of 110 VAC. • For pivots with STANDARD A/R panel: a)  The YELLOW/RED wire must be connected to Terminal T23. From this moment, iControl Remote  will have a supply voltage of 110 VAC. b)  The PINK wire must be connected to Terminal T24 to enable the iControl Remote to control a pump/ valve, as indicated in step 2. 8.   Connect the pivot energy supply. 9.   Access the web address https://icontrolremote.com . You will be asked to enter a user name and          password: use the last six digits of the iControl Remote serial number. For example, for the serial           number 357042061393945, the default user name is: 393945 and the password is: 393945. Note: This login is provisional for the installer, and it will be canceled once the controller is assigned         to its owner in the administration platform (iCAP). It is very important that once the installation is com        plete, the equipment should be assigned to its owner in iCAP. 10.  An interface similar to that shown on previous pages will appear, which includes a widget for the iCon         trol Remote device that has just been installed. 11 . Congratulations! You can now configure this pivot from its control panel and access the iControl        Remote Cloud service remotely https://icontrolremote.com. 12.  In the first place, the correct coordinates of the pivot point must be established. This can be done in          the Setup tab by entering the coordinates directly, or else you can obtain them if using a mobile device          by clicking the Use the GPS location button in your telephone. 13.  For further information read the iControl Remote manual or contact the local assistance service. For                security reasons, assigning an owner in iCAP is required as soon as possible to disable the 6-digit           installer username. iControl Remote Installation Manual...
  • Page 8: Troubleshooting

    WIRELESS MODELS: 90017-WL8B, 90017-WL8S, 90017-WL9B, 90017-WL9S Is there radio coverage throughout the sweep area of the last tower box? Radio coverage in the entire area  covered by iControl Remote 2 Wireless is necessary to be able to link the controller to the Gateway. It is very important that there should exist a direct line of sight between the iControl Remote and the Gateway. Note: Exceptionally, an iControl Remote which does not have a direct line of sight with the Gateway can be  installed, although using a second iControl Remote that does have a direct line of sight with the Gateway. ...
  • Page 9 Troubleshooting Section Title 9 9 9 9 POWER supply status LED iControl Remote v2 -  GREEN: supply present -  OFF: no supply. Reset button Communications status LED ICR2-Wireless -  Steady: The radio is not linked to any node. -  Flashing (0.5s). The radio is linked to a node.  ICR2-3G/4G -  Steady: There is no connection with the server. -  Flashing (0.5s): There is a connection with the server. iControl Remote Installation Manual...
